4. Step by step: Activating Google Play Store on your Android device

To activate the Google Play Store on your Android device, follow these simple steps:

Step 1: Check the Internet connection on your device. Make sure you are connected to a Wi-Fi network or have an active mobile data connection.

Step 2: Go to the settings of your Android device. You can access it by swiping down from the top of the screen and tapping the settings icon. You can also find the Settings app in your device's app menu.

Step 3: Once in settings, scroll down and look for the “Accounts” or “Accounts & Sync” section. Tap this option.

Step 4: In the accounts section, select the “Add account” or “Add account” option (depending on the version of Android you are using).

Step 5: Select the “Google” option from the list of available account types. This will take you to the Google login screen.

Step 6: Enter your Google login credentials, that is, your email address and password associated with your google account.

Step 7: Once you've entered your credentials, you'll be presented with a series of options to sync your data and settings. You can review them and select the ones you want. If you are only interested in activating the Google Play Store, you can uncheck the other options.

Step 8: Tap the “Next” or “OK” button to complete the account setup. Your Google account will be added to the list of accounts on your device.

5. Solving common problems when activating Google Play Store

To fix common issues when activating the Google Play Store, follow these steps:

1. Check the internet connection: Make sure your device is connected to a stable Wi-Fi network or mobile data network. Check that the signal is strong and stable to ensure a proper connection to the Google Play Store.

2. Clear Google Play Store cache and data: Open your device's Settings and look for the apps or installed apps section. Find Google Play Store in the list and select it. Within the app's settings, select "Storage." In this section, you will find the option to clear cache and data. Click on it and confirm the cleaning. This can help resolve store loading or update issues.

3. Check the date and time of the device: Make sure you have the correct date and time on your device. If the date and time are out of date, the Google Play Store may have problems working correctly. You can adjust these settings in the Settings section of your device.

8. Update and manage Google Play Store for optimal performance

The Google Play Store is an essential platform for downloading, updating and managing applications on Android devices. However, it can sometimes present performance problems that affect the user experience. Fortunately, there are measures that can be taken to solve these problems and ensure optimal operation of the app store.

One of the most important steps in keeping the Google Play Store up to date and optimized is to ensure that you are running the latest version available. To do this, follow these steps:
1. Open the app from the Google Play Store on your Android device.
2. Touch the menu icon in the upper left corner of the screen.
3. Scroll down and select “Settings”.
4. In the “General” section, tap “Automatically update apps.”
5. Select “Update automatically over Wi-Fi only” or “Update anytime.”
6. Make sure you have enough storage space on your device for updates.

Another way to improve the performance of the Google Play Store is to clear the cache and stored data. This can help resolve slow loading issues or errors when downloading or updating apps. Follow these steps to clear cache and data:
1. Go to “Settings” on your Android device.
2. Select “Applications” or “Application Manager”.
3. Find and select “Google Play Store” from the list of installed apps.
4. Tap “Storage” or “Cache Storage.”
5. Tap “Clear Cache” and then “Clear Data.”

In addition to the steps above, there are other measures that can be taken to improve the performance of the Google Play Store. These include:
– Restart your Android device.
– Check your Internet connection and make sure it is stable and fast.
– Uninstall unnecessary or rarely used applications to free up storage space.
– Reset your device to factory settings as a last resort.

13. Alternatives to Google Play Store for unsupported Android devices

If you have an Android device that is not compatible with the Google Play Store, don't worry. There are many alternatives that you can use to download applications on your device. Here are some options that might work for you:

1. Aptoid: It is a mobile application distribution platform that has a wide variety of applications and games to download. You can install Aptoide from its official website and then use it as an alternative app store to Google Play Store.

2.APKMirror: This website is a great option for downloading APK files of popular apps, including old and current versions. There is no registration required to download apps from APKMirror, which makes it very convenient.

3.F-Droid: F-Droid is an open source app store that focuses on offering free and open source apps. You can download the F-Droid app from its official website and use it to search and download apps that might not be available on the Google Play Store.
